#python #excel #postgresql #psycopg2
Вопрос:
Я знаю, что мы можем экспортировать данные таблицы Postgres в MS Excel с помощью Python. Но, используя Python, есть ли возможность экспортировать данные таблицы Postgres в MS Excel, добавив данные к существующим данным листа Excel? Примечание: Вместо того, чтобы делать это вручную каждый день, я хочу автоматизировать процесс с помощью Python, чтобы экспортировать данные таблицы Postgres в MS Excel, добавив данные на основе даты.
Ответ №1:
Вы можете получить данные из postgres с помощью psycopg2 и создавать файлы Excel с помощью xlsxwriter . Остальное заключается в настройке переменных с данными БД и размещении переменных в файле excel
Проверьте документацию для xlsxwriter и psycopg2
Комментарии:
1.
xlswriter
только для записи он не может добавлять данные в существующую электронную таблицу. Для этого вам понадобится что-то вроде openpyxl